Drivetrain Architecture
The Internal combustion engine (ICE) and the electric motor permanently drive the rear wheels of the vehicle, capable of running in full electric or mixed mode, and if necessary through the electrically or mechanically controlled clutch, the front wheels are driven.

Battery - Electric / Hybrid
The Mercedes-Benz GLC is a plug-in hybrid electric vehicle with a lithium-ion battery pack located under the trunk, offering an all-electric range of 12 km (7.46 mi). It features a synchronous electric motor producing 204 Hp and 320 Nm of torque, with a maximum speed of 140 km/h (86.99 mph) in electric mode.
